-
-
[旧帖]
大侠们快来帮新手破处
0.00雪花
-
发表于:
2007-4-7 20:59
4405
-
这两天在看雪看了几篇学习文章,也想亲自破~~~~~~~~~~~~~一个,于是随便找了个来破,不想运气真TMD的不好,找到的这个是被别人破过了的,于是又花了点时间找了个原装未破的。
软件名称:TypingMasterENG7.0.720 (一个小的指法练习软件 有附件)
软件安装后在安装目录里面有4个exe文件,如下
TypingMaster.exe tmaster.exe KBoost.exe unins000.exe
快捷方式用的是TypingMaster.exe 但是好像执行的是 tmaster.exe
看了一下tmaster.exe,无壳 Delphi。
操作步骤如下:
1 用Ollgdbg将tmaster.exe打开
2 在00523CF4下断点
3 F9
4 点击 Enter license 按钮,在License ID:的编辑框输入ABCDEFG;在Product Key:编辑框输入
987654321,然后点击Enter按钮。
5 程序停在00523CF4即license 程序处理的入口处;
6 F8 跟下去看到如下:
00523D57 E8D8D2F0FF call 00431034 ;得到 Product Key
.
.
00523D98 E897D2F0FF call 00431034 ;得到 License ID
.
.之后是检查License ID 和License ID是否为空。。。如果不为空就开始验证
.
开始一系列的验证 ,(就是没有找到关键的地方)。
我将00523F1B 7539 jnz 00523F56
改成00523F1B 7539 je 00523F56
后运行程序,提示我输入的license已经被认可了,但是当我回到主程序后看到,被限制的功能还是没能解除限制,所以刚才该的哪个地方只是让最后的提示信息正确了。并没有找到关键点。
请各位高手出手相救。请尽量写详细一点,小弟水平有限。
[注意]传递专业知识、拓宽行业人脉——看雪讲师团队等你加入!